In Focus | Carla McKenzie

Meet Carla. Carla is originally from Grand Forks and has been living here in Kelowna on and off for about 20 years now! She enjoys running and exploring the city, browsing the local goodies at the farmers' market, and spending some quality time with her family and friends.

<who> Photo Credit: Carla McKenzie
Where are you from and how long have you lived in Kelowna?

I was adopted from India when I was 2, raised in Grand Forks, and have lived on & off in Kelowna since 1998 (permanently here now).

Who is your favourite person to spend time with and why?
This is a tie between my 2 children and my closest running friends (the spuds).

What is your favourite local store in Kelowna and why?
I really, really like to eat. I love QB gelato and the farmers' market. I also like Leo’s Videos and Mosaic Books.

Describe yourself in one word.
Stubborn (or determined, depending on how you look at it).

If you could go anywhere in the world right at this moment where would you go and why?
Hawaii, to run.

<who> Photo Credit: Carla McKenzie
What is your favourite activity in Kelowna?

Running and exploring our city on foot. I also love going to the farmers' Market.

What is the most embarrassing thing that has happened to you?
Apparently, I don’t get embarrassed easily because I can’t think of a single thing!

Tell us your favourite childhood memory.
Climbing trees, riding bikes, walking to school, drinking from the hose - all with no worries!

Where do you volunteer or give back to in the community?
I am always trying to teach (& encourage) my children to volunteer and give back. Our favourite volunteering activity to do as a family is delivering Christmas presents for Kelowna Santas. With my daycare, we do Thanksgiving food hampers and Christmas presents for several families. I love watching children as young as one-year-olds, get involved!

If you could change one thing in the world what would it be?
That all children in the world have a (safe) home.

<who> Photo Credit: Carla McKenzie
Where would you sneak away to in Kelowna to spend some time alone?

Alone time? What’s that?!!

What do you think makes Kelowna great?
The weather, the people, the restaurants and especially all of the amazing activities we have for children!

What are 3 things on your bucket list?
1. Bali marathon (I LOVE Bali and marathons so it would be great to be able to combine them).
2. Ironman
3. To take my kids on an African safari.

Tell us something that not everyone may know about you.
I hate coffee.

<who> Photo Credit: Carla McKenzie
How do people connect with you, personally, through social media? (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, LinkedIn, etc.)

Facebook & Instagram

What is the name of your business/organization?
Glenmore Educational Daycare

Why did you get into/start this business?
I love working with children and I have two small children of my own.

What is the goal of your business?
To provide quality childcare and build lasting relationships.

What has been your biggest struggle either at work or in life?
Balancing it all: work, my kids, me.

<who> Photo Credit: Carla McKenzie
If you could start all over again would you do things the same or would things be different?

Exactly the same except I would have started saving money when I was a child.😂

What do you always find yourself saying?
Go big or go home. However, according to my daughter, I’m always saying: you’re the best!

Tell us your best piece of life advice.
"You didn’t come this far to only come this far."

If you could spend one whole day with anyone in the world who is currently alive, who would you select?
Ellen DeGeneres

What has been your proudest accomplishment?
The past 5 years: my business, my children, my running, and the friendships I have made.

<who> Photo Credit: Carla McKenzie
Give someone you think that deserves it a shout out and explain why!

My mom. She adopted me when I was young and I would have a completely different life without her. She has also taught me a lot about determination and perseverance.
